Fees, refunds, and what you can realistically expect
This is where most people get nervous, and for good reason. The Copa Airlines cancellation fee and refund rules depend on whether the ticket is refundable, whether the airline changed the trip, and how long ago the ticket was issued. Copa says refund eligibility is tied to fare rules, and the refund goes back to the original form of payment when it is approved. It also notes that bank posting can take up to eight weeks depending on the billing cycle.
There is also a big difference between a voluntary cancellation and an involuntary one. If Copa is responsible for a disruption, such as a mechanical problem or another airline-caused issue, the airline says passengers may request a full or partial refund, as applicable. Copa also states that ticket fees for unused optional services can be refunded when a flight is canceled or oversold.
That means the reason behind the cancellation matters just as much as the cancellation itself. A voluntary change in plans is not treated the same way as a flight disruption caused by the airline. Copa Airlines cancellation and refund: when money comes back
When people search Copa Airlines cancellation and refund, they usually want one answer: “Will I get my money back?” The honest answer is that it depends on the fare and the situation. Fully refundable fares can be returned through the refund request process. Non-refundable fares may not return cash, but Copa says they can keep value for future use if they are still valid.
Refund timing also depends on how the ticket was paid for. Copa says credit card refunds may appear on one of the next two statements after processing, cash refunds may be immediate, and check refunds may be issued within 10 business days.

What happens if Copa cancels my flight
This is one of the most important questions in any Copa Airlines cancel flight policy discussion. If the airline cancels your flight, you are no longer dealing with a standard voluntary cancellation. In those situations, you may qualify for a refund or another remedy depending on the route, the delay, and the local rules. Copa’s help pages note that flights affected by cancellations or delays greater than 4 hours can be refundable, and its U.S. passenger rights page says unused optional service fees should be refunded when a flight is canceled or oversold.
That is a very different situation from choosing to cancel on your own. If the airline changed the trip in a major way, the conversation shifts from “Can I cancel?” to “What compensation or refund applies?”
